What Materials Are Cookware Protectors Made From?

The best cookware protectors are made from a variety of materials, each offering unique benefits for protecting your cookware.

  • Felt: Felt is a popular choice for cookware protectors due to its soft texture, which prevents scratches and dents on cookware surfaces. It is durable and can withstand frequent use, making it a reliable option for separating pots and pans.
  • Silicone: Silicone protectors are flexible and heat-resistant, which allows them to not only protect cookware but also withstand high temperatures. They are easy to clean and often come in various colors, adding a decorative element to your kitchen storage.
  • Foam: Foam protectors provide cushioning and absorb shock, making them ideal for fragile items like non-stick pans. They are lightweight and can easily be cut to fit different sizes of cookware, offering a custom solution for protection.
  • Microfiber: Microfiber is known for its softness and absorbency, making it a great choice for protecting cookware from scratches. This material is also machine washable, ensuring that the protectors remain clean and effective over time.
  • Cotton: Cotton protectors are breathable and often used for vintage or delicate cookware. They are gentle on surfaces and can be easily washed, providing a natural and eco-friendly option for those looking to protect their cookware sustainably.

What Are the Benefits of Using Fabric Cookware Protectors?

The benefits of using fabric cookware protectors include enhanced protection for your cookware, improved storage efficiency, and increased longevity of your pots and pans.

  • Protects Against Scratches: Fabric cookware protectors create a soft barrier between stacked pots and pans, preventing scratches and dents that can occur during storage. This is especially important for non-stick and delicate finishes that can be easily damaged.
  • Reduces Noise: When stacking cookware, especially metal pots, the clanging noise can be bothersome. Fabric protectors dampen this sound, making it quieter and more pleasant to handle your cookware.
  • Improves Organization: Using protectors allows for better organization of your kitchen cabinets or drawers by providing a structured way to stack cookware. This makes it easier to access pots and pans without having to dig through a chaotic pile.
  • Prevents Heat Damage: Some cookware materials can warp or get damaged if they come into contact with hot surfaces or other heated pans. Fabric protectors can help insulate and protect against heat transfer, preserving the integrity of your cookware.
  • Versatile Use: Fabric cookware protectors can be used not just for pots and pans but also for baking dishes, skillets, and even glassware. Their versatility makes them a practical addition for anyone looking to maintain the quality of a variety of kitchen items.

What Key Features Should You Look for in Cookware Protectors?

When selecting the best cookware protectors, consider the following key features:

  • Material: Look for cookware protectors made from durable materials like felt or silicone, as they provide adequate cushioning and protection for your pots and pans. Felt is particularly effective in preventing scratches, while silicone offers additional heat resistance.
  • Size and Shape: Ensure the protectors come in various sizes and shapes to fit different cookware dimensions, including skillets, saucepans, and lids. This versatility allows you to use them across your entire cookware collection without needing different products for each piece.
  • Thickness: A thicker protector can offer better cushioning and protection against impacts and scratches. However, balance the thickness with storage concerns, as overly thick protectors may take up too much space when stacking cookware.
  • Non-slip Feature: Some protectors have a non-slip surface that prevents them from shifting while stacking cookware. This feature is crucial for ensuring that the protectors stay in place, keeping your cookware securely protected during storage.
  • Washability: Opt for protectors that are easy to clean, either machine washable or wipeable. This feature is important for maintaining hygiene and keeping your cookware protectors in good condition over time.
  • Eco-friendliness: Consider choosing protectors made from eco-friendly materials that are safe for both your cookware and the environment. Sustainable options often include recycled materials, which can be a great choice for environmentally conscious consumers.

How Can You Choose the Right Size for Your Cookware Protectors?

Choosing the right size for your cookware protectors is essential to ensure optimal protection for your pots and pans.

  • Measure Your Cookware: Start by measuring the diameter of your pots and pans to determine the correct size of the protectors needed.
  • Consider the Material: Different materials may require different thicknesses and types of protectors, so consider the material of your cookware when selecting protectors.
  • Account for Nested Cookware: If you stack your cookware, ensure that the protectors are large enough to fit between each piece without causing damage.
  • Check for Adjustable Options: Some protectors come in adjustable sizes, which can provide a versatile solution for various cookware sizes.
  • Look for Specific Fit: Some brands offer protectors designed specifically for certain types of cookware, such as non-stick or cast iron, which can enhance protection.

Measuring your cookware accurately is crucial since protectors that are too small might not provide sufficient coverage, while those that are too large may not fit properly in your cabinets. Use a measuring tape to get precise dimensions and consider both the base and the top of the cookware for a comprehensive fit.

When considering the material of your cookware, keep in mind that some protectors are designed with softer materials to prevent scratches on delicate non-stick surfaces, whereas others may be made of thicker, more durable materials suitable for heavier items like cast iron. Selecting the right material will help maintain the integrity of your cookware over time.

If you often stack your pots and pans, it’s important to choose protectors that can fit snugly between each piece without shifting or bunching up. This not only prevents scratches but also keeps your cookware organized and easily accessible.

Adjustable options can be particularly beneficial for those who have a variety of cookware sizes. These protectors can be modified to fit different diameters, providing flexibility and saving you the need to purchase multiple sizes.

Lastly, opting for protectors that are specifically designed for certain cookware types can offer additional benefits. For example, protectors made for non-stick cookware might have a softer surface to prevent damage, while those for stainless steel may be designed to withstand higher heat and abrasion.

How Can You Make DIY Cookware Protectors at Home?

Making DIY cookware protectors at home is a simple and cost-effective way to keep your pots and pans in pristine condition.

  • Felt Pads: These soft pads can be cut to size and placed between cookware to prevent scratches and dents.
  • Dish Towels: Using clean dish towels as protectors is an easy and accessible method to cushion your cookware.
  • Old T-shirts: Repurposing old cotton T-shirts into circles or squares can provide a gentle barrier for your pots and pans.
  • Cardboard Cutouts: Cardboard can be cut into shapes that fit your cookware, offering a rigid layer of protection against stacking damage.
  • Silicone Baking Mats: These versatile mats can be trimmed to size and used to separate cookware, as they provide a non-stick surface.

Felt Pads: Felt pads are made from soft fabric that absorbs impact and prevents scratches. By cutting them into appropriate sizes for your pots and pans, you can easily create customized protectors that will keep your cookware scratch-free while also being aesthetically pleasing.

Dish Towels: Dish towels are readily available in most kitchens and can be used effectively as cookware protectors. Simply fold the towel a few times for added cushioning and place it between your pots and pans, which will help absorb shock during storage.

Old T-shirts: Old cotton T-shirts are an eco-friendly option for making cookware protectors. By cutting the fabric into circular or square shapes, you create soft barriers that prevent metal-on-metal contact, thus preserving the finish of your cookware.

Cardboard Cutouts: Cardboard is a sturdy material that can be shaped into protective cutouts for cookware. This method works well for larger items and provides a firm surface to keep your cookware from touching and scratching each other during storage.

Silicone Baking Mats: Silicone mats are flexible and durable, making them an excellent choice for protecting cookware. They can be easily cut to fit various sizes and provide a non-slip surface that prevents slipping and sliding when stacking your pots and pans.
